WebThere are many greetings or mihi used in Māori. Here are some that are commonly used. Kia ora (Greetings, Hello) Kia ora koutou (Greetings, Hello to you – 3 or more people) … WebStarting a te reo Māori journey. If whānau are keen for their tamaiti to learn te reo Māori, talk with them about their use of the language at home and their connections to te ao Māori. If they lack confidence in speaking themselves, assure them that there are many ways they can bring te reo into their home and whānau.
